About Neal Prevost

I have been a practicing trial attorney since 1993. Most of that work has been in the area of family law. I have been involved in almost a thousand family law cases, including both property and custody disputes. And, I have seen the ugliest of what two people who were once madly in love can do to each other.

When I began my practice I thought I could actually "win" your divorce. In reality, all I ever did was to manage how bad the loss was going to be. Divorce is never win-win. It is always lose-lose.

My Decision To Write

After a few years of practice, I noticed that I was seeing the same fact patterns over and over. I began to recognize the types of belief systems and behaviors that lead to divorce. I guess I could say that I have come to clearly recognize what does NOT work.

I have also come to believe that if a couple can recognize early enough that they are in the danger zone, then they would have a better chance of saving their marriage. I also came to see the terrible price paid by the children of divorce.

They are the most innocent in the divorce process, and they do not even get to vote. I believe that almost twenty five years of practice has given me something valuable to share, so I began to put my thoughts into writing.
